Question 1: During strategy execution, 'initiative fatigue' most commonly results from which condition?
- Launching too many simultaneous strategic projects without adequate resources (Correct answer)
- Setting overly ambitious financial targets
- Poor competitor analysis
- Excessive use of balanced scorecards
Correct answer: Launching too many simultaneous strategic projects without adequate resources
Initiative fatigue occurs when organizations pursue too many concurrent projects, spreading resources and management attention too thin to execute any well.
Question 2: Which governance mechanism best ensures that strategic decisions made at the top are implemented consistently at the front line?
- Annual strategy retreats
- Performance management systems with strategy-linked incentives (Correct answer)
- External consultant audits
- Open-door leadership policies
Correct answer: Performance management systems with strategy-linked incentives
Performance management systems that tie individual and team incentives directly to strategic objectives create accountability throughout the hierarchy.
Question 3: A strategic initiative has a champion but no clear owner for day-to-day execution tasks. What risk does this create?
- Budget overruns due to champion authority
- Accountability gaps leading to delayed or incomplete execution (Correct answer)
- Excessive reporting burden on senior executives
- Premature closure of the initiative
Correct answer: Accountability gaps leading to delayed or incomplete execution
Without a designated operational owner, no one is accountable for daily progress, creating gaps that cause delays or incomplete delivery.
Question 4: In the context of strategy execution, 'strategic learning' refers to which process?
- Training employees on competitive intelligence tools
- Using execution feedback to test and refine strategic assumptions (Correct answer)
- Benchmarking competitors' learning and development programs
- Conducting post-mortems after project failures only
Correct answer: Using execution feedback to test and refine strategic assumptions
Strategic learning uses data from execution results to validate or challenge the assumptions embedded in the strategy, enabling adaptive management.
Question 5: Which of the following is the BEST indicator that an organization's strategy execution is on track?
- Positive net promoter scores
- Leading indicators tied to strategic objectives are hitting targets (Correct answer)
- Year-over-year revenue growth exceeds industry average
- Employee satisfaction scores are above 80%
Correct answer: Leading indicators tied to strategic objectives are hitting targets
Leading indicators (e.g., customer acquisition rates, process cycle times) provide early signals of whether strategic objectives will be achieved, making them the best execution health check.
Question 6: A firm discovers mid-year that a critical execution assumption—that a key supplier would scale capacity—was incorrect. The BEST response is to:
- Continue with the original plan to avoid signaling weakness
- Trigger a structured strategy review to adapt the plan (Correct answer)
- Replace the responsible manager
- Defer the issue to the next annual planning cycle
Correct answer: Trigger a structured strategy review to adapt the plan
When a key assumption is invalidated, a structured strategy review allows the organization to adapt quickly rather than continuing on a flawed trajectory.
Question 7: Cross-functional strategy execution teams often struggle most with which structural issue?
- Excessive meeting frequency
- Dual reporting lines and unclear decision authority (Correct answer)
- Overabundance of strategic data
- Lack of project management software
Correct answer: Dual reporting lines and unclear decision authority
Members with divided loyalties between functional and strategic reporting lines often face unclear authority, slowing decisions and creating accountability confusion.
